This book is a collection of research and scholarly papers presented at the seventh training course in the field of manuscript editing, organized by the Center for the Study of Islamic Manuscripts at Al-Furqan Islamic Heritage Foundation and Dar al-Hadith al-Hassania, from March 3 to 8, 2014, at Dar al-Hadith al-Hassania in Rabat.

The research addresses the history of editing in the sciences of the noble Prophetic Hadith and the science of biographies and sheikhdoms, both theoretically and practically. It covers the steps followed and encompasses all the tasks required by the editor, whether on a theoretical level—such as the scientific concept of editing, its principles, methodologies, and problems, and the sources the editor should be familiar with—or on a practical level, such as selecting and authenticating the text, searching for and critiquing its copies, exploring its traditions, the process of transcription and collation, editing and processing, annotation, and study. Additionally, it deals with correcting scribal errors and distortions, variations in narrations within Hadith manuscripts, and textual paratexts: their types, classification, and the benefits they hold, etc.
